Ranil’s Oath Taking Delayed

Due to the delay in announcing the final election result, the oath taking ceremony of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e which was slated to happen today has been postponed, party sources said.

Earlier in the day Minister John Amaratunge had said that Wickremesinghe will take oaths before the President in the afternoon.

Meanwhile, both President Maithripala Sirisena and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e were engaged in lengthy talks on forming of the new government today, party sources said.

The UNP which secured 106 seats fell short of an absolute majority by 07 seats. However, some UPFA members who are loyal to President Sirisena are likely to join the government.

Meanwhile the Elections Department a short while ago announced the bonus seats allocated for each political party. The Bonus seats allocations are as follows, UNP 13, UPFA 12, JVP 2, ITAK 2, SLMC 1, EPDP 1.

With the bonus seats, the United National Party has secured 106 seats while the United People’s Freedom Alliance (UPFA) has secured 95 seats. The JVP’s tally meanwhile is 06 and ITAK 16 seats, SLMC 1 and EPDP 1.

The United National Party claimed victory at the 2015 parliamentary polls receiving 5,098,927 votes which is 45.66 percent of the votes.

The main opposition United People’s Freedom Alliance (UPFA) where the former president Mahinda Rajapaksa led the campaign received 4,732,669 or 42.38 percent of votes.

Ilankai Tamil Arasu Kadchi (ITAK), the major constituent in the Tamil National Alliance (TNA) claimed victory in the Tamil-dominated Northern Province receiving 515,963 or 4.62 percent of votes.

The Janatha Vimukthi Peramuna received 4.87 percent of the vote amounting to 543,944.
